Prime Factorization Method-. Step 1: Find the prime factors of the first number 36. We will get, → 2, 2, 3, 3; Step 2: Find the prime factors of the second number 60. We will get, → 2, 2, 3, 5; Step 3: Multiply of all the common prime factors is the GCF value. WebNow that we have the list of prime factors, we need to find any which are common for each number. List the multiples of each number until at least one of the multiples appears on all lists; Find the smallest number that is on … WebOct 15, 2010 · The GCF of 36, 60, and 96 is 12. 36 = 2 2 3 3. 60 = 2 2 3 5. 96 = 2 2 2 2 2 3. Select the intersection of these sets, 2 2 3, multiply, and you get 12.
